Useful Tips to Keep in Mind When Finding a Roofer
When you’re looking for prospective roofing contractors who can take on your project, one of the first things to check is their license and insurance. It’s proof that they’re working legally in the state, and most contractors readily have it with them. They should also have general liability insurance and worker’s compensation so that you won’t be forced to shoulder the expenses in case your property gets damaged or someone gets injured while your roof construction is ongoing.
